8 oz (225g) of cuts of a bacon joint
a little butter
1 lb (450g) parsnips
8 oz (225g) ham, chopped
8 oz (227g) can of peeled tomatoes
salt and pepper
3/4 cup (50 g) fresh white breadcrumbs
2 oz (50g) cheese, grated
method
1. Heat the oven to 350°F (180°C) mark 4.
2. Butter a 1 1/2 pt (900ml) heatproof dish.
3. Peel the parsnips and cut in quarters lengthwise. Remove the hard centres and cut across into thin slices.
4. Place the parsnips and ham in the dish and pour over the tomatoes. Season well with salt and pepper.
5. Mix together the breadcrumbs and cheese and sprinkle over the top of the dish. Dot with a little butter.
6. Cook in the oven for about 40 minutes or until the parsnips are tender and the breadcrumbs are golden brown and crisp on top.
